The Growing Importance of OSINT in Global Intelligence
OSINT, the process of collecting and analyzing publicly available data, has transformed intelligence operations. From social media posts to satellite imagery, the volume of open-source data is staggering. For the U.S. intelligence community, OSINT provides a cost-effective way to monitor geopolitical developments, track adversarial activities, and identify emerging threats. In the Middle East, where political instability and security concerns dominate, OSINT is indispensable for understanding regional dynamics, including China's growing influence through initiatives like the Belt and Road Initiative (BRI).
China, with its tightly controlled internet and vast digital infrastructure, presents unique challenges for OSINT practitioners. The Great Firewall, state-controlled media, and widespread censorship make it difficult to access and verify information. Yet, China's role as a global economic and military power means that intelligence professionals cannot afford to overlook it. Challenges of OSINT in China
Conducting OSINT in China requires navigating a labyrinth of technical and cultural barriers. Some of the key challenges include:
- Censorship and Data Restrictions: China's Great Firewall blocks access to many Western websites and social media platforms, while domestic platforms like WeChat and Weibo are heavily monitored. Intelligence professionals must find ways to access and analyze data from these platforms without triggering censorship mechanisms.
- Language and Cultural Barriers: Mandarin Chinese, with its unique writing systems and regional dialects, poses a significant hurdle. Additionally, understanding cultural nuances and state propaganda is critical for accurate analysis.
- Disinformation and Propaganda: The Chinese government actively shapes narratives through state media and online campaigns. Distinguishing between authentic and manipulated information is a constant challenge.
- Data Overload: The sheer volume of data generated on platforms like Douyin (China's TikTok) and Baidu requires sophisticated tools to filter and analyze relevant information efficiently.
These challenges are particularly relevant for U.S. and Middle Eastern intelligence communities, who are increasingly focused on China's activities in areas like technology exports, cybersecurity, and regional influence in the Middle East.

OSINT Applications in U.S. and Middle Eastern Contexts
The U.S. intelligence community is increasingly reliant on OSINT to monitor China's global activities. For example, OSINT has been used to track Chinese cyberattacks, such as the 2021 Microsoft Exchange Server hack attributed to Chinese state-sponsored actors. Similarly, OSINT plays a role in analyzing China's military modernization, including its naval expansion in the South China Sea.
In the Middle East, OSINT is critical for understanding China's economic and diplomatic engagements. The BRI has led to significant Chinese investments in countries like Saudi Arabia, the UAE, and Egypt. Intelligence professionals use OSINT to assess the strategic implications of these investments, such as China's access to key ports and energy resources. Additionally, OSINT helps monitor China's role in regional conflicts, including its arms exports and mediation efforts in disputes like the Yemen crisis.
